Maharashtra Tourism Development Corporation (MTDC) is responsible for the development and promotion of tourism of the state. Find information about the state's history, arts and crafts, cuisine, museums and festivals. Users can get information about Ajanta caves, Ellora caves, Raigarh fort, shrines, beaches, hill stations and sanctuaries etc. Details of places of interest in Amravati, Aurangabad, Kolhapur, Mumbai, Nagpur and Pune are also provided.

The Maharashtra Tourism Development Corporation (MTDC) is eyeing a 40% rise in properties under its ‘Bed and Breakfast’ scheme by year-end to compete with private players like AirBnB, which rent out leased properties to tourists. The scheme was first launched in 2015, but gained popularity primarily after the Covid-19 pandemic.

Deccan Odyssey

Deccan Odyssey India is the fruitful outcome of the joint venture of Indian Railway and Maharashtra Tourism Development Corporation (MTDC) that gave birth to the royal luxury train in India. The train derives its name from its journey route that covers the places located in the Deccan Plateau of India. This blue Limousine on rail took several months to finalize its design and after years of relentless effort, the train started its maiden journey on January 16, 2004. Deccan Odyssey India covers host of precisely chosen destinations that include Mumbai, Sindhudurg, Goa, Kolhapur, Daulatabad, Chandrapur, Ajanta Caves and Nasik. All these places are unique in the sense that each of them has a specialty of their own and thus every new day comes in a form of fresh surprise for the guests. By understanding the travel requirements of the guests, the destinations are chosen so that a complete picture of Maratha lifestyle, heritage and history can be presented to the travelers. All the 21 luxuriously appointed coaches of Deccan Odyssey are the jewels of a crown. Out of these 21 coaches, 11 are to accommodate guests and the rest are used for different purposes such as dining, lounge, conference car and health spa. All the cabins of Deccan Odyssey are fully equipped with facilities like air-conditioning, internet connectivity and personalized guest amenities that make sure that your journey would be a comfortable and memorable one. Moreover, the multi-cuisine restaurant, well stocked bar, high-tech conference cart and a spa & massage cabin onboard add on the colors of merriment to your entire jaunt.

Tariff Chart

Tariff: Cabin Occupancy/    Deluxe Cabin     Presidential Suite Cabin Type Single                               US$ 5250              US$ 7700 Double                            US$ 8050              US$ 12800 Triple                               US$ 10500            US$ 15855 Terms & Conditions: Children below 5 years old can travel at 10% of the total journey cost. Half fare is applicable for the children between 5 to 12 years of age. It is mandatory for all the guests to submit the age proof of children at the time of issuance of tickets. 10% surcharge will be levied on the Christmas and New Year departures. Service Tax @ 3.09% is applicable on the total journey price. Cost of journey is subject to change without prior information. Inclusions/Exclusions: The Deccan Odyssey Tariff includes the following: Travel, catering, conducted sightseeing, entrance fee at monuments, parks, palaces and boat rides. The Deccan Odyssey Tariff does not include: Fees for video camera, charges for laundry and telephone calls, drinks, business car facilities, liquor and tips etc.

Facilities onboard Deccan Odyssey covers an array of services that include regal class cabins, multi-cuisines restaurants, sitting lounge, high-tech conference car and a rejuvenating health spa. The signature of utmost comfort and pampering treatment, Deccan Odyssey facilities make you feel special even in the crowd. Cabin: Echoing the penchant of the erstwhile Maharajas, all the 12 guest accommodation coaches of Deccan Odyssey is outfitted with cozy furniture and personalized guest amenities. Complemented by the very best of personal services, travelling on the private cabins of this deluxe rail is a unique rail tour experience in India. When you travel in these elegant class cabins of the train, you can feel that the inside décor reflects several moods to suit the outside views of the landscape. All the cabins are spacious enough where guests can roam freely. The decoration of each coach reflects a particular era of the Deccan milieu and is creatively outfitted with facilities like personal safe, telephone, attached bathroom, air-conditioning and a personal attendant on the round the clock service of the guests. Dining & Cuisines: The Deccan Odyssey has two multi-cuisine restaurants- PeshwaI & Peshwa II. The brilliantly decorated interiors of these restaurants add on more flavors to each gourmet dish served by the restaurant stewards in traditional Maharashtra attire. The large selection of Indian, oriental and continental delicacies offer the travelers the freedom to choose their favorite one from the list. The fresh aroma of varied dishes welcome the guests to the restaurant cart of Deccan Odyssey. The relaxed ambience of the restaurants, the fragile hospitality of the stewards and the ever changing views of the outside world make the guests savor each bite of their food to its fullest extent. Bar: The onsite bar of Deccan Odyssey, Mumbai Hi, is the ultimate place to taste some of the best varieties of wines and spirits collected from all around the world. Along with that the bar also serves non-alcoholic beverages in a relaxing ambiance. The decoration of the bar is simple yet elegant that exhausts the entire day fatigue of the excursion tours to different forts and palaces. Unwind and relax in Mumbai Hi of Deccan Odyssey with a fine glass of wine in your hand. Sitting Lounge: Though the royal rail journey with Deccan Odyssey will never make you feel bore, but the train also has a sitting lounge where guests can relax and chat with their fellow travelers while on the go. You can also pick up a book available in this lounge and take a deep plunge into the writings of the eminent authors. Conference Car: Keeping in view the travelling requirements of the corporate voyagers, a conference car has also been provided on board Deccan Odyssey India. This particular conference car is fully equipped with high-tech amenities and audio-visual equipment required for a successful business venture. To take care of all the corporate endeavors, the train also offers hospitality services crafted according to the needs of the traveler. Health Spa: Every voyager expects their traveling days to be relaxing and in Deccan Odyssey we understand this need quite well. The health spa center onboard gives the voyagers a chance to discover the refreshing side of your personality and appearance with pampering spa and massage therapies. From the treasure trove of ancient Indian science Ayurveda, the secrets of rejuvenations have been used so that the entire jaunt can be turned into a regenerating experience for the travelers.

Maharashtra CM launches MTDC initiatives to boost tourism

Thackeray launched initiatives such as a new boat club at ganpatipule in ratnagiri, a renovated mtdc resort at sinhagad fort in pune, and a new website of mtdc that will go live from wednesday..

maharashtra tourism development corporation (mtdc)

Chief Minister Uddhav Thackeray on Tuesday launched a string of initiatives of the Maharashtra Tourism Development Corporation (MTDC) to boost tourism.

Thackeray launched initiatives such as a new boat club at Ganpatipule in Ratnagiri, a renovated MTDC resort at Sinhagad fort in Pune , and a new website of MTDC that will go live from Wednesday.

maharashtra tourism development corporation (mtdc)

MITDC also signed Memoranda of Understanding with online travel companies MakeMyTrip and Goibibo to promote MTDC properties and with M/s SkyHigh India to start skydiving and adventure sports activities. An MoU was also signed with Maharashtra State Institute of Hotel Management and Catering Technology, Pune, for annual training of MTDC staff.

The CM said the state has a wide variety of destinations to attract domestic and international tourists, which will boost the economy and provide employment to youths. “Two things are required to boost tourism. One is what we can offer to a wider range of tourists. Secondly, we must ensure that we come up with new tourist attractions,” he said.

He said the state has several destinations that can go on world map. “Like Amsterdam’s Tulip Garden, we can also develop tourism around flowers on Kaas Pathar in Satara,” he said.

Festive offer

Tourism Minister Aaditya Thackeray said these initiatives are aimed at promoting Maharashtra as the most sought-after tourist destination to the world.

Maharashtra Tourism Development Corporation

Lorem Ipsum

MTDC or Maharashtra Tourism Development Corporation was set up on the regulations of Companies Act 1956 under Govt of Maharashtra, aiming at the work on development of tourism in a systematic and commercial line with a starting capital on shared basis of Rs 25 crore. As of 2008, 31st March, the corporation has a capital share of Rs 15.38 lakhs. Financial help is received by the Corporation from State Government as grants and share capital. All the activities pertaining to promotion of tourism and commercial activities have been entrusted on the corporation by the government of Maharashtra.

Since its beginning, MTDC has been looking after the maintenance and development of different locations of touristic importance in Maharashtra. This corporation even has its own resorts and maintains them at different centres of touristic importance with many more resorts on the cards.
